eccrine /ec·crine/ (ek´rin) exocrine, with special reference to ordinary sweat glands.
eccrine [ek′rin] Etymology: Gk, ekkrinein, to secrete pertaining to a sweat gland that secretes outwardly through a duct to the surface of the skin. See also exocrine. eccrine exocrine, with special reference to glands that secrete their product without loss of cytoplasm. See sweat glands. eccrine tumors adenomas and adenocarcinomas occur rarely.
